为了账号安全,请及时绑定邮箱和手机立即绑定

这么设置className为什么是错的

这么设置className为什么是错的

qq_Mo_9 2017-03-12 22:40:45
<!DOCTYPE html><html lang="en"><head>    <meta charset="UTF-8">    <title>Title</title>    <style> *{            margin: 0; padding: 0; }        ul{            margin: 50px auto; background-color: #bab5b9; width: 240px; height: 360px; }        li{            width: 60px; height: 60px; margin-left: 15px; background-color: #666666; list-style: none; float: left; margin-top: 15px; }        div{            width: 200px; height: 160px; background-color: #bb5655; margin: 0 auto; }         .g{             background-color: #00ff90; }    </style>    <script> window.onload=function () {            var ali=document.getElementsByTagName("li"); var adiv=document.getElementById("a"); var i=0; for(i<ali.length;i++){                ali[i].onclick=function () {                    for(i=0;i<ali.length;i++){                        ali[i].className=""; }                    this.className="g"; }            }        }    </script></head><body><ul>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li>    <li>cakak</li></ul><div id="a"></div></body></html>
查看完整描述

1 回答

  • 1 回答
  • 0 关注
  • 1034 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信